About The Role

Peraton is seeking a Linux Systems Administrator / Engineer with a strong background in RHEL administration, enterprise operations, and DoD security/compliance standards for its' PDSS program. This role is responsible for the health, stability, and performance of a large and growing Red Hat Enterprise Linux environment while also serving as one of the primary contributors to security hardening, vulnerability remediation, and RMF compliance activities.

The ideal candidate is an experienced Linux engineer who enjoys owning full-stack system operations—builds, patching, automation, monitoring, troubleshooting—while also driving strong security outcomes.

Key Responsibilities: 

  • Manage the lifecycle of a 150+ node RHEL environment including provisioning, patching, configuration management, and system optimization.

  • Perform troubleshooting across OS, application, network, and storage layers in collaboration with other engineering teams.

  • Maintain system availability, performance, and reliability through proactive monitoring, tuning, and root-cause analysis.

  • Support deployments, upgrades, modernization initiatives, migrations, and infrastructure expansion projects.

  • Develop and enhance automation for common operational tasks using Ansible, Bash, and Python.

  • Administer core services (e.g., SSH, systemd, logging, networking, NFS/SMB, web services, SELinux).

  • Apply and maintain DISA STIGs and DoD security baselines across Linux systems.

  • Conduct vulnerability scanning (ACAS/Nessus/OpenSCAP), evaluate CVEs, and drive remediation efforts.

  • Participate in RMF/ATO documentation, evidence collection, audit support, and POA&M maintenance.

  • Ensure consistent application of security controls, patch standards, and system compliance requirements.

  • Integrate Linux logs and events into enterprise security and monitoring platforms (Splunk, syslog, etc.).

  • Support implementation of authentication, MFA, certificate-based access, and secure communications.
